Grant Description
The purpose of this project is to support an elephant conservation effort in Benin and Mozambique by strengthening the implementation of a robust ivory stockpile management system.

Benin and Mozambique are home to approximately 2,984 and 10,884 elephants respectively.

This project is intended to conserve African forest and savanna elephants and their habitat by addressing the impacts of poaching and ivory trafficking.

Specific activities include:

(1) Training government officials on the use of the stockpile management system (SMS);

(2) Developing standard operating procedures and inventory of wildlife products in target storerooms;

(3) Conducting follow-up technical support and mentoring to ensure continued use of SMS in 12 African countries; and

(4) Conducting a physical audit of an ivory stockpile in Uganda.

Amendment Since initial award the End Date has been extended from 01/31/24 to 06/30/24.
The Elephant Protection Initiative Foundation was awarded Project Grant F22AP01404 worth $147,555 from FWS Headquarters in February 2022 with work to be completed primarily in Benin. The grant has a duration of 2 years 4 months and was awarded through assistance program 15.620 African Elephant Conservation Fund. $6,083 (4.0%) of this Project Grant was funded by non-federal sources. The Project Grant was awarded through grant opportunity African Elephant Conservation Fund.
